About the role
This part-time, onsite position supports the Division of Cardiothoracic Transplant Surgery by assisting with operational and financial needs, including insurance verification, marketing efforts, and analyzing referring physician patterns for increased outreach opportunities.
Responsibilities
- Serves as the point of contact for all Chronic Thromboembolic Pulmonary Hypertension (CTEPH) patients.
- Oversees business development for adult cardiac services, including outreach tasks to increase physician referrals, network integrity, referral capture, social media, and marketing initiatives.
- Manages the insurance process for the Division of Cardiothoracic Transplant Surgery, including verification of consults, studies, and surgical approvals.
- Drafts, organizes, and sends letters to referring physicians.
- Manages faculty credentialing, reappointments, and license renewals.
- Reviews and ensures budget control by managing faculty CME, travel, and Concur expense reports.
- Assists the Division Administrator with budget development.
- Takes inventory of clinic supplies and orders supplies as needed.
- Ensures Division Faculty ongoing research protocols are kept up to date through training and re-credentialing.
- Coordinates meetings, events, retreats, and other functions.
- Performs other job-related duties as assigned.
Requirements
- High School diploma or GED.
- Two years of relevant experience.
Preferred Qualifications
- Insurance verification and referral experience.
